заставить программу работать через proxy
заставить программу работать через proxy
Как заставить программу работать через proxy: технический гид без иллюзий
Заставить программу работать через proxy — и не попасть в ловушку
Заставить программу работать через proxy — задача, с которой сталкиваются миллионы пользователей в России ежедневно. Кто-то хочет обойти блокировку Telegram или YouTube, кто-то скачивает торренты, а кто-то просто не доверяет своему провайдеру «Ростелеком» или «МТС». Но большинство гайдов молчат о том, что proxy — это не панацея. Он может утечь DNS, передать реальный IP через WebRTC или вообще оказаться шлюзом для сбора ваших данных. В этом материале — только проверенные методы, честные предупреждения и инструменты, которые реально работают в 2026 году.
Почему стандартные настройки не спасают
Большинство приложений игнорируют системные настройки прокси. Браузеры — да, они читают параметры Windows или macOS. А вот торрент-клиенты, мессенджеры, игры и даже некоторые офисные программы — нет. Они используют собственные сетевые стеки и подключаются напрямую к интернету.
Пример: uTorrent по умолчанию не использует системный прокси. Если вы просто включили SOCKS5 в Windows, торрент всё равно пойдёт через ваш реальный IP. То же касается Discord, Steam, Zoom и многих других.
Чтобы гарантированно заставить программу работать через proxy, нужно либо:
- Настроить прокси внутри самой программы (если есть такая опция);
- Использовать сторонние инструменты вроде Proxifier, ProxyCap или ручной маршрутизации через
iptables/nftables; - Запускать приложение в изолированном окружении (например, через Docker с перенаправлением трафика).
Каждый способ имеет свои подводные камни — от утечек до полного отказа соединения.
Чего вам НЕ говорят в других гайдах
Бесплатные прокси — это бизнес на вас
Бесплатные HTTP/SOCKS-прокси, которые вы находите в открытых списках, почти всегда:
- Логируют весь ваш трафик;
- Подменяют рекламу (вставляют свои баннеры);
- Снижают скорость до 1–3 Мбит/с;
- Работают на устаревшем ПО с известными уязвимостями.
В 2024 году исследователи из Cure53 обнаружили, что 78% бесплатных прокси-сервисов внедряли JavaScript-трекеры прямо в HTML-страницы пользователей. Это не теория заговора — это практика монетизации.
Fake kill switch
Многие VPN-клиенты заявляют о наличии «kill switch», но на деле он работает только в рамках самого клиента. Если вы используете сторонний прокси через Proxifier, отключение VPN не остановит другие приложения — они продолжат слать трафик в открытую сеть. Реальный kill switch должен блокировать весь исходящий трафик на уровне ядра ОС или роутера.
Юрисдикция и принудительная выдача данных
Даже если сервис заявляет «no logs», это ничего не значит, если он зарегистрирован в стране-участнице 14 Eyes (например, Нидерланды, Германия, Франция). По решению суда такие компании обязаны сохранять и передавать данные. В 2025 году немецкий провайдер IVPN был вынужден предоставить метаданные по запросу BKA — несмотря на политику no-log.
Утечки через WebRTC и DNS
Прокси типа HTTP/SOCKS не шифруют DNS-запросы, если явно не указано обратное. Ваш браузер может отправить DNS-запрос напрямую провайдеру, даже если весь HTTP-трафик идёт через прокси. То же касается WebRTC — он раскрывает локальный IP вне зависимости от прокси. Отключайте WebRTC вручную или используйте браузеры с встроенной защитой (Brave, Firefox с настройками).
Типы прокси: что выбрать и когда
| Тип прокси | Шифрование | Поддержка UDP | Анонимность | Подходит для торрентов | Скорость |
|---|---|---|---|---|---|
| HTTP | Нет (или TLS) | Нет | Низкая | ❌ | Высокая |
| HTTPS | Да (TLS) | Нет | Средняя | ❌ | Средняя |
| SOCKS4 | Нет | Нет | Средняя | ❌ | Высокая |
| SOCKS5 | Нет (опционально через SSH) | Да | Высокая | ✅ | Высокая |
| Shadowsocks | Да (AES, ChaCha20) | Да | Очень высокая | ✅ | Очень высокая |
SOCKS5 — единственный тип прокси, который поддерживает UDP. Это критично для торрентов, VoIP и онлайн-игр. Но помните: SOCKS5 сам по себе не шифрует трафик. Для защиты используйте его поверх SSH или WireGuard.
Shadowsocks — де-факто стандарт в странах с жёсткой цензурой (Китай, Иран). Он маскирует трафик под обычный HTTPS, что помогает обходить DPI (Deep Packet Inspection). В России его пока не блокируют массово, но он отлично работает против провайдерских фильтров.
Как заставить конкретную программу работать через proxy
- Через настройки самой программы
Некоторые приложения поддерживают прокси «из коробки»:
- qBittorrent: Инструменты → Настройки → Соединение → Прокси-сервер.
- Telegram Desktop: Настройки → Дополнительно → Прокси.
- Discord: Настройки → Сеть → HTTP-прокси (только для API, не для медиа!).
Проверьте документацию вашей программы — часто опция скрыта в «расширенных» настройках.
- Через Proxifier (Windows/macOS)
Proxifier перехватывает все сетевые вызовы приложений и направляет их через указанный прокси.
Шаги:
1. Установите Proxifier.
2. Добавьте прокси: Profile → Proxy Servers → Add.
3. Создайте правило: Profile → Proxification Rules → Add.
- Application: выберите .exe нужной программы.
- Action: Use proxy.
4. Запустите программу — весь её трафик пойдёт через прокси.
⚠️ Важно: Proxifier не шифрует трафик. Если прокси ненадёжный — ваши данные в открытом виде.
- Через iptables (Linux)
Если вы используете Linux, можно перенаправить трафик конкретного пользователя через прокси:
Создаём нового пользователя для изоляции
sudo useradd -m vpnuser
Запускаем прокси-сервер (например, Dante SOCKS)
sudo systemctl start danted
Перенаправляем трафик этого пользователя через прокси
sudo iptables -t nat -A OUTPUT -m owner --uid-owner vpnuser -p tcp -j REDIRECT --to-port 1080
Теперь любое приложение, запущенное от vpnuser, будет использовать прокси.
- Через роутер с OpenWrt
На роутере можно настроить policy-based routing:
- Устройства в VLAN «Work» — идут через прокси.
- Остальные — напрямую.
Это особенно полезно для IoT-устройств, которые не поддерживают прокси (умные лампочки, камеры).
Проверка: действительно ли работает?
Не верьте на слово. Проверяйте:
- IP-адрес: зайдите на ipleak.net. Должен отображаться IP прокси.
- DNS-утечки: тот же сайт покажет, какие DNS-серверы используются. Должны быть серверы прокси или публичные (Cloudflare, Google), но не вашего провайдера.
- WebRTC: browserleaks.com/webrtc — должен показывать только IP прокси.
- UDP-трафик: для торрентов используйте qBittorrent с включённым DHT и проверьте, есть ли пиры. Если нет — UDP не проходит.
Если хоть один тест провален — ваша программа не работает через прокси полностью.
Сценарии использования в России
Журналист в командировке
Вы в кафе с публичным Wi-Fi. Чтобы не стать жертвой MITM-атаки, вы запускаете Proxifier + SOCKS5 через SSH-туннель на своём VPS. Весь трафик шифруется, DNS идёт через Cloudflare DoH. WebRTC отключён в браузере.
Айтишник на кофеварке
Разрабатываете приложение, которое должно работать в условиях блокировок. Тестируете через Shadowsocks-прокси, чтобы имитировать условия пользователей в регионах с ограничениями.
Пользователь торрентов
Использует qBittorrent с настроенным SOCKS5 и включённым kill switch на роутере. Все UDP-пакеты идут через прокси, DNS — через него же. Проверяет утечки раз в неделю.
Обход блокировки мессенджера
Telegram заблокирован на уровне провайдера? Добавьте прокси в настройках клиента. Но лучше использовать MTProto-прокси — они официально поддерживаются Telegram и не снижают скорость.
Сравнение реальных решений (2026)
| Сервис / Инструмент | Юрисдикция | Логи | Протоколы | Цена (мес.) | Реальная скорость (Мбит/с)* | Аудит |
|---|---|---|---|---|---|---|
| Proxifier + VPS | Любая | Нет (если свой VPS) | SOCKS5/SSH | от 300 ₽ (VPS) | 90–95% от канала | Самостоятельный |
| IVPN | Швейцария | No logs | WireGuard, OpenVPN | $6 | 85–90% | Cure53 (2024) |
| Mullvad | Швеция | No logs | WireGuard, OpenVPN | €5 | 88–92% | Assured AB (2025) |
| Hola Free Proxy | Израиль | Полные логи | HTTP/SOCKS | Бесплатно | 1–3 | Нет |
| Shadowsocks (самостоятельно) | Любая | Нет | Shadowsocks | от 200 ₽ (VPS) | 95–98% | Зависит от реализации |
* При подключении к серверу в Москве, канал 100 Мбит/с.
Обратите внимание: бесплатные решения теряют 90–95% скорости и собирают данные. Даже если вы «ничего не скрываете» — ваша история посещений, устройства, геолокация становятся товаром.
Вывод
Заставить программу работать через proxy — это не просто включить настройку и забыть. Это комплексная задача, требующая понимания сетевых протоколов, угроз утечек и юридических рисков. В 2026 году недостаточно выбрать «любой прокси» — нужно проверить, поддерживает ли он UDP, шифрует ли DNS, не логирует ли трафик и не находится ли в юрисдикции, где вас могут принудительно идентифицировать.
Лучший подход — использовать SOCKS5 поверх шифрованного туннеля (SSH/WireGuard) или Shadowsocks для обхода DPI. Избегайте бесплатных сервисов. Тестируйте каждую конфигурацию на утечки. И помните: если приложение не поддерживает прокси нативно, без Proxifier, ProxyCap или маршрутизации на уровне ОС не обойтись.
Техника здесь проста. Главное — не верить маркетингу и проверять всё самостоятельно.
VPN замедляет интернет на сколько реально?
Зависит от протокола и расположения сервера. WireGuard добавляет 5–15 мс пинга и снижает скорость на 5–10%. OpenVPN — 10–30 мс и 10–20% потерь. Бесплатные прокси — до 95% потерь. При подключении к серверу в том же городе (например, Москва) разница почти незаметна.
Меня найдёт спецслужба при использовании VPN?
Если вы используете легальный коммерческий VPN с no-log политикой и юрисдикцией вне 14 Eyes — шанс минимален. Но если сервис логирует данные или зарегистрирован в РФ/ЕС — по решению суда ваши метаданные могут запросить. Анонимность не гарантируется законом — только техническими мерами.
WireGuard или OpenVPN — что безопаснее?
Оба протокола безопасны при правильной настройке. WireGuard быстрее, проще и использует современные криптоалгоритмы (ChaCha20, Curve25519). OpenVPN проверен временем, но сложнее в конфигурации и уязвим к утечкам при плохой реализации. WireGuard не поддерживает динамические IP в базовой версии — это важно для мобильных устройств.
Можно ли использовать прокси вместо VPN?
Можно, но с оговорками. Прокси не шифрует весь трафик (только приложение), не защищает от DNS/WebRTC-утечек и не блокирует рекламу/трекеры. Для полной защиты лучше использовать VPN. Прокси удобен для точечных задач: обход блокировки одного сайта или запуск одной программы.
Как проверить, не утекает ли мой IP через WebRTC?
Зайдите на browserleaks.com/webrtc. Если отображается ваш реальный IP — WebRTC активен. В Firefox: about:config → media.peerconnection.enabled = false. В Chrome — установите расширение WebRTC Leak Prevent или используйте браузер Brave.
Бесплатный прокси в Telegram — это безопасно?
MTProto-прокси в Telegram шифруют трафик между клиентом и сервером, но сам прокси-оператор видит, что вы используете Telegram. Он не видит содержимое сообщений, но знает время подключения, объём трафика и ваш IP. Если прокси публичный — это риск. Лучше использовать официальные прокси от Telegram или настроить свой.
Комментарии
Комментариев пока нет.
Оставить комментарий